Danai Udomchoke and
Oscar Hernandez have met 1 time. Danai Udomchoke currently holds the upper hand, leading the series 1–0.
Looking at their individual career profiles, Danai Udomchoke has compiled an overall career record of 60–71 across 131 matches, translating to a win rate of 45.80%. On hard courts his record stands at 44–50 (46.81%), while on clay he holds a 5–6 (45.45%) mark. On grass the numbers read 6–13 (31.58%) , and on carpet 5–2 (71.43%). Against Top 10 opponents his record reads 0–6 (0.00%).
Oscar Hernandez, on the other hand, enters this matchup with a career mark of 65–125 from 190 matches (34.21% win rate). His hard-court record is 5–32 (13.51%), on clay he stands at 59–84 (41.26%), and on grass he has gone 1–9 (10.00%) . Against Top 10 opponents his record stands at 0–9 (0.00%).
When it comes to their head-to-head meetings, the surface breakdown reveals this contrast. On grass, their 1 encounter has yielded a record of 1–0 (100.00% for Danai Udomchoke).
